Anna Bossman, Gina Blay, Papa Owusu Ankomah get ambassadorial roles

President Akufo Addo has named Gina Blay, Anna Bossman, Papa Owusu Ankoma and Baffour Adjei Awuah as Ghana’s missions to some four countries as part of his appointments.

These men and women would represent the government in those nations. The four were given their letters of credence on Friday June 2, 2017 by President Akufo Addo at the Flagstaff House.

Madam Ginna Blay is heading to Germany, Anna Bossman, former head of the Commission for Human Rights and Administrative Justice (CHRAJ) heads to France, Papa Owusu Ankoma, former Member of Parliament for Sekondi heads to the United Kingdom (UK) and Baffour Awuah, former ambassador to Japan under the Kufour administration is going to the United States of America (USA).

3news.com sources have also hinted that former Attorney General, Ayikoi Otoo would be heading to Canada as ambassador, former Sports Minister Rashid Bawa may be going to Nigeria and one Edward Boateng would be on his way to China.

The president will soon release the names and destinations of his representatives to other countries.
